
Wright State Athletics Joins The Fight To Cure HD
12/29/2014 5:00:00 AM | Men's Basketball
Wright State Athletics has joined the fight against Huntington's Disease, an congenital brain disorder that results in the progressive loss of both mental capacities and physical control. The Raiders have teamed with former WSU baseball standout and current Los Angeles Angels of Anaheim pitcher Joe Smith and his family who are raising awareness and research funds to find a cure for HD.
Smith's grandmother suffered from the disease. His mother, Lee, is currently battling HD.
“Joe and his parents, Mike and Lee, have been a part of the Wright State family since Joe first came to campus more than a decade ago”, said WSU Director of Athletics Bob Grant. “When we see members of our family who are in a battle like the one the Smiths are in, we are eager to join the fight.”
Wright State will be raising awareness and funds for HD research beginning on Wednesday, January 14, when the Raiders' men's basketball team hosts Cleveland State. The game will feature Smith and his fiancé, Allie LaForce from CBS Sports, meeting fans for autographs and photos on the party deck above section 201 from 6:00-7:00 pm. The men's basketball team will be wearing blue shoes to show their support, and Wright State Athletics will donate $1 to the Cleveland Clinic “Help Cure HD” Research Fund for every person attending the game.
“My family and I are grateful for all of the support the Raider family is contributing to fight this disease that has had a great effect on our family,” said Smith. “We are looking forward to working with WSU and Wright State fans to help reach our goals of raising awareness of HD, and raising $2 million for HD research.”
Wright State Athletics will continue to raise awareness and funds after the game, including an event at a WSU baseball game this season.
